If I do not get victory in first round, all presidential candidates will stand against Deuba: Prakash Man Singh



KATHMANDU: Nepali Congress (NC) presidential candidate Prakash Man Singh has claimed that he will bag victory in the first phase of the election to take place in the 14th General Convention.

Speaking to the reporters at the general convention site Bhrikutimandap, Kathmandu on Monday, leader Singh remarked that he will be victorious in the contest for party President.

“I win in the first round,” he said. If there is no result in the first phase, we will defeat Deuba together in the second phase,” he said.

Earlier, another presidential candidate Bimalendra Nidhi had also vowed to support others to defeat President Deuba if the election goes to the second round.
